He was born June 14, 1928, in Hopwood, son of the late Dewey and Anna Chaney Durst. In addition to his parents, he is predeceased by two brothers, Darrel and James Durst.
He is survived by his loving wife, friend and care giver of 58 years, Bertha M. Jeffries Durst; three sisters: Veda Edwards of Rising Sun, Md., Norma Jean Balas and husband, Robert of Burton, Ohio, and June Ann Durst of Uniontown; and a very special friend, Judy Snyder of Uniontown.
Roy was a retired employee of South Union Township, and he was a veteran of the Korean War, where he received several medals and honors.
He was a member of the Harley Davidson Owners Group and the Fayette County A.B.A.T.E. and loved to ride his Harley with his friends.
Friends will be received in the DONALD R. CRAWFORD FUNERAL HOME, Hopwood, Friday from 9 a.m. to 1 p.m. the hour of service with the Rev. Roland O’Brian officiating.
Interment will follow in Sandy Hill Cemetery, New Salem Road.
